On Tue, Nov 25, 2008 at 03:06:46PM -0500, Andrew wrote:
>I did.  No response though :-( And again, I doubt the guide is at
>flaw..since every other site has roughly the same instructions.

It's unlikely that every other site tells you to edit cygwin.bat.
If that was really a requirement then we'd do this at start time
not tell everyone to do it.

The instructions at this site actually go against what we consider
to be good practice.  For instance, this:

mount -s --change-cygdrive-prefix /

is not something that we endorse.

So please don't characterize this as standard advice.  It isn't.
